CARE: These woven pieces are sturdy and made to last. They’re also meant to be used, and because life happens, sometimes they get a little out of shape. You can reshape your bag by spraying creased areas with water and pressing into your desired shape. The material should feel damp but not saturated. Add water slowly to get a feel for what your piece needs and avoid color bleeding. Let dry, avoiding direct sunlight, or placing on fabrics. Repeat as necessary.
If you notice stray fibers just give them a trim, this is totally normal!
The artisan sector is the second largest employer in the developing world. Yet the majority of artisans are women who lack access to export markets, business skills, and the financial tools needed to run successful, global enterprises.
Indego Africa is dedicated to changing that by investing 100% of their profits into education programs for the women who handcraft their products and youth in their communities. Since 2007, they have provided over 1,100 artisans and 250 young people in Rwanda & Ghana with employment opportunities, entrepreneurship training, and consistent access to the global export market.
